The search is on for Europe's most creative film on what it takes to be an entrepreneur.

For the second time, the European Commission's Directorate-General for Enterprise and Industry is inviting imaginative filmmakers to participate in the European Entrepreneurship Video Awards (EEVA 2010). Participants can register until April 9 at http://ec.europa.eu/eeva 2010 .

The European Entrepreneurship Video Award is divided into categories: 'Entrepreneurship - A different way of life', 'Entrepreneurship - Challenges and rewards' and 'Entrepreneurship - The way into the future'.

Prizes of €3,333, €2,222 and €1,111 will be awarded respectively to the winner, second and third placed in each category. In addition, five of the best contestants aged 25 or younger who have not qualified for one of the nine prizes in these categories, will be awarded €555 each.

The competition is open to all natural and legal persons who are citizens or residents of a member state of the EU, Norway, Iceland, Liechtenstein, Croatia, Macedonia, Montenegro, Albania, Serbia, Turkey and Israel.

The awards are part of European SME Week, an initiative aimed at promoting entrepreneurship across Europe and informing entrepreneurs in small and medium-sized enterprises about the support available at European, national, regional and local level.
